• Здравствуйте, коллеги.
    Кто знает, как убрать Платежный адрес со страницы «оформление заказа»
    в версии Вукоммерс 8.9.3.
    WP 6.5.5.
    Найденные на этом форуме решения не работают (устарели).

    Пару лет назад делал магазин WC (7.3.0) и работала вставка:
    add_filter( ‘woocommerce_checkout_fields’, ‘woo_no_billing_fields’ );
    function woo_no_billing_fields( $fields ) {
    unset( $fields[‘billing’][‘billing_company’] );
    unset( $fields[‘billing’][‘billing_address_1’] );
    unset( $fields[‘billing’][‘billing_address_2’] );
    unset( $fields[‘billing’][‘billing_city’] );
    unset( $fields[‘billing’][‘billing_postcode’] );
    unset( $fields[‘billing’][‘billing_country’] );
    unset( $fields[‘billing’][‘billing_state’] );
    unset( $fields[‘shipping’][‘shipping_first_name’] );
    unset( $fields[‘shipping’][‘shipping_last_name’] );
    return $fields;
    }

    Сейчас такое не работает.

    Попробовал плагины:
    WooCommerce Checkout Manager
    Checkout Field Editor (Checkout Manager) for WooCommerce
    Через них все поотключал. Но ничего не отключилось.

    Основы PHP знаю, в крайнем случае придётся находить и вырезать, но хотелось бы найти более цивилизованный способ.

    Кто сталкивался?

Просмотр 4 ответов — с 1 по 4 (всего 4)
Просмотр 4 ответов — с 1 по 4 (всего 4)